    What's the best entertainment value in OC for $5.00? For many, it's CSUF Women"s gymnastics meet at…read moreTitan Gym. There are usually four or five meets per year at home. As of this writing, they have one more home meet and the conference championships (which will likely cost more) at CSUF in 2010. I found out about this program once when I was a student here playing tennis one Sunday. All of the sudden, people flocked to the parking lot and onto Titan Gym. It's a great place to take little girls who can see how beautiful and strong they can grow and maybe even have their Olympic dreams. There's few places where can you see fit strong and beautiful women defy gravity/ as they tumble, dance, and swing. UCLA has a gymnastics team also, but they're 60 miles or so away. NCAA gymnasts compete on the floor exercise. Watch for girls who flip in the air twice before landing and show off their personality as they dance to music. On vault, they also sprint down the floor then vault off a "horse", fly high, then flip or twist around before landing. On the uneven bars, they need to do ten moves, including a release when they throw themselves off the bar, re-catch, and pirouette on top of the bar while in a handstand, and swing out and flip or twist and land cleanly.The balance beam is where these ladies have to do a floor exercise routine on a beam that is 4 inches wide and four feet off the floor. It takes years daily practice for several hours to do a routine in a minute and thirty seconds. Gymnasts have the highest injury rate of any NCAA sport except springtime football training.
